Many species have modified the operculum in specialized zooids ( avicularia ) to form a range of mandibles ( probably for defense ) or hair-like setae ( probably for cleaning, or in some unattached species, such as " Selenaria ", for locomotion ).

Avicularia are categorised by their position relative to the autozooids . "'Vicarious "'avicularia effectively replace an autozooid in the colony structure and are usually a similar size and shape as the autozooids . "'Interzooidal "'avicularia are wedged between autozooids but do not replace an autozooid . "'Adventitious "'avicularia are placed somewhere on the external ( frontal ) wall of an autozooid and are usually much smaller.
